Palestinian Prisoners' Day: Over 9,600 held in Israeli prisons amid torture, starvation and abuse
The article reports on the recent Palestinian Prisoners' Day, which highlighted the plight of over 9,600 Palestinians held in Israeli prisons. The article argues that the prisoners are being subjected to torture, starvation, and abuse, and that the international community must take action to support their release.

The number of Palestinian casualties in the conflict
| Outlet | Claim |
|---|---|
| Middle East Eye | Over 736 Palestinians have been killed since the October ceasefire |
| TRT World | Over 765 Palestinians have been killed since the October ceasefire |
